Referring to fig. 1-3, the present embodiment provides a technical solution: the maintenance hanging basket for the wind power tower protection platform comprises a hanging basket body 1 and an adjusting unit 4;
the hanging basket body 1: the four corners of the upper side are respectively provided with a limiting ring 2 which is in fit connection with the outer side of the rope, and the left side and the right side of the hanging basket body 1 are respectively provided with a buffer unit 3;
the buffer unit 3 comprises a first sliding groove 31, a first sliding block 32, a first spring 33 and a supporting plate 34, wherein the first sliding groove 31 is formed in the front end and the rear end of the left side and the rear end of the hanging basket body 1 respectively along the vertical direction, the first spring 33 is arranged in each sliding groove 31, the first sliding blocks 32 are arranged in two, the first sliding blocks 32 are respectively connected with the inner sides of the corresponding sliding grooves 31 through the two corresponding first springs 33 in a sliding mode along the left-right direction, and the supporting plate 34 is arranged between the outer sides of the two corresponding first sliding blocks 32 at the left end and the right end respectively in the front-back direction.
The sliding blocks 32 slide under the action of the sliding grooves 31, and the corresponding sliding blocks 32 have inward buffering force under the action of the springs 33, so that the corresponding supporting plates 34 have inward buffering force, and the outside of the basket body 1 is protected by the supporting plates 34.
The buffering unit 3 further comprises a long key groove 35 and a key block 36, the upper side and the lower side of the inside of each sliding groove one 31 are respectively provided with the long key groove 35 along the left-right direction, and the upper end and the lower end of each sliding block one 32 are respectively in sliding connection with the inner side of the corresponding long key groove 35 along the left-right direction through the key block 36.
Under the action of the sliding connection between the upper end and the lower end of each sliding block I32 and the inner side of the corresponding long key groove 35 along the left-right direction through one key block 36, the sliding blocks I32 can stably slide in the corresponding sliding grooves I31.
The adjusting unit 4: the hanging basket comprises a second sliding groove 41, a second sliding block 42, electric telescopic rods 43, hanging basket end portions 44, a third sliding groove 45, a third sliding block 46 and locking assemblies, wherein a second sliding groove 41 is formed in the lower ends of the left and right sides of the interior of the hanging basket body 1 respectively in the front-back direction, the electric telescopic rods 43 are respectively arranged at the rear ends of the interior of the two sliding grooves 41, the second sliding blocks 42 sliding in the front-back direction are respectively arranged at the front ends of the two electric telescopic rods 43 and correspond to the inner sides of the second sliding grooves 41, the hanging basket end portions 44 sliding in the left and right sides of the interior of the hanging basket body 1 are arranged between the inner sides of the two sliding blocks 42, the third sliding grooves 45 are respectively formed in the upper ends of the left and right sides of the interior of the hanging basket body 1 in the front-back direction, the rear ends of the left and right sides of the hanging basket end portions 44 are respectively connected with the inner sides of the corresponding third sliding grooves 45 in the front-back direction through the third sliding blocks 46, and the locking assemblies are arranged in the interior of the third sliding grooves 45 in the interior of the slide blocks.
Make hanging flower basket main part 1 better through the effect that the rope realized the oscilaltion through spacing ring 2, increase the shock-absorbing capacity in the hanging flower basket main part 1 outside through buffer unit 3, drive two sliders 42 through two electric telescopic handle 43 and slide along the fore-and-aft direction in the inside of corresponding spout two 41, slide through two sliders two 42 and drive hanging flower basket tip 44 and slide along the fore-and-aft direction between the inboard of hanging flower basket main part 1, thereby realize the regulation effect to hanging flower basket main part 1 inner space, can realize the maintenance effect to more positions in the wind-powered electricity generation tower protection platform outside, slide through hanging flower basket tip 44 and drive slider three 46 and slide in the inside of the spout three 45 that corresponds, realize the fixed action to slider three 46 at spout three 45 inner position through locking Assembly, thereby realize the fixed action to hanging flower basket main part 1 upper end.
The locking assembly comprises square grooves 47, U-shaped grooves 48 and U-shaped blocks 49, the lower side of the inside of each sliding groove III 45 is respectively and uniformly provided with at least six square grooves 47 along the front-back direction, the inside of each sliding block III 46 is respectively provided with one U-shaped groove 48 with a downward opening, the inside of each U-shaped groove 48 is respectively and vertically connected with one U-shaped block 49 in a sliding manner, and the lower end of the outer side of each U-shaped block 49 is respectively connected with the inner side of the corresponding square groove 47 in a matching manner.
The U-shaped block 49 can slide under the action of the U-shaped groove 48, and the slider three 46 can be fixed in the inner position of the sliding groove three 45 under the matching connection action between the lower end of the outer side of the U-shaped block 49 and the inner side of the corresponding square groove 47.
The locking assembly further comprises a sliding groove IV 410 and a sliding block IV 411, the inner side of each U-shaped groove 48 is provided with the sliding groove IV 410, the inner end of each sliding groove IV 410 penetrates through the inner side of the hanging basket end portion 44, and the inner side of each U-shaped block 49 is connected with the inner side of the corresponding sliding groove IV 410 in a sliding mode in the up-down direction through the sliding block IV 411.
The fourth sliding block 411 is driven by external force to slide in the fourth sliding groove 410 along the vertical direction, and the sliding of the fourth sliding block 411 drives the U-shaped block 49 to slide in the U-shaped groove 48 along the vertical direction.
The locking assembly further comprises springs 412, one spring 412 is disposed on the inner upper side of each U-shaped groove 48, and the lower end of each spring 412 is fixedly connected to the upper side of the corresponding U-shaped block 49.
The U-shaped block 49 has a downward force under the action of the spring 412, and the downward force of the U-shaped block 49 makes the fitting connection between the lower ends of the outer sides of the U-shaped block 49 and the inner sides of the corresponding square grooves 47 more stable.
The utility model provides a wind power tower protection platform overhauls theory of operation of hanging flower basket as follows:
the hanging basket body 1 can better realize the function of lifting up and down through a rope through the limiting ring 2, the first sliding blocks 32 can realize the sliding function under the function of the first sliding grooves 31, the corresponding first sliding blocks 32 can have inward buffering force under the function of the first springs 33, so that the corresponding support plates 34 can have inward buffering force, the outer side of the hanging basket body 1 can be protected through the support plates 34, the upper end and the lower end of each first sliding block 32 can stably realize the sliding function in the corresponding first sliding grooves 31 under the function of sliding connection between a key block 36 and the inner sides of the corresponding long key grooves 35 along the left-right direction, the two sliding blocks 42 can be driven to slide in the front-back direction in the corresponding second sliding grooves 41 through the two electric telescopic rods 43, and the hanging basket end part 44 can be driven to slide in the front-back direction between the inner sides of the hanging basket body 1 through the sliding of the two sliding blocks 42, thereby realizing the regulation effect on the internal space of the hanging basket body 1 and the maintenance effect on more positions outside the wind power tower protection platform, the sliding of the hanging basket end part 44 drives the sliding block three 46 to slide in the corresponding sliding groove three 45, the sliding block four 411 is driven to slide in the sliding groove four 410 by external force, the sliding of the sliding block four 411 drives the U-shaped block 49 to slide in the inner side of the U-shaped groove 48 along the up-and-down direction, the U-shaped block 49 realizes the sliding effect under the effect of the U-shaped groove 48, the fixing effect on the internal position of the sliding block three 46 in the sliding groove three 45 is realized under the matching connection effect between the lower end of the outer side of the U-shaped block 49 and the inner side of the corresponding square groove 47 respectively, thereby realizing the fixing effect on the upper end of the hanging basket body 1, and the U-shaped block 49 has a downward force under the effect of the spring 412, the fitting connection between the outer lower ends of the U-shaped blocks 49 and the inner sides of the corresponding square grooves 47, respectively, is more stabilized by the downward force of the U-shaped blocks 49.
